#475ccb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#475ccb is composed of 27.8% red, 36.1% green and 79.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65% cyan, 54.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 20.4% black. It has a hue angle of 230.5 degrees, a saturation of 55.9% and a lightness of 53.7%. #475ccb color hex could be obtained by blending #8eb8ff with #000097.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#475ccb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04060f is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#475ccb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#87878b is the less saturated color, while #1a3df8 is the most saturated one.
